Page MenuHomePhabricator

Formally EOL MW 1.39
Closed, ResolvedPublic

Description

As per https://www.mediawiki.org/wiki/Version_lifecycle, MW 1.39 is EOL at the end of December 2025.

Previous (in date order): T389313: Formally EOL MW 1.42

As per the MediaWiki version lifecycle[1], I would like to announce the formal end of life (EOL) of MediaWiki 1.39 as of December 31, 2025.

1.39.17 is expected to be the last release for this branch.

This means that MediaWiki 1.39 will no longer receive maintenance or security backports. It is therefore strongly discouraged that you continue to use it.

It is recommended to upgrade either to the next LTS, 1.43, which will be supported until the end of December 2027. Or to either MediaWiki 1.44, which will be supported until the end of July 2026, or to MediaWiki 1.45, which will be supported until the end of December 2026.

Thanks!

[1] https://www.mediawiki.org/wiki/Version_lifecycle

Related Objects

Event Timeline

Reedy set Due Date to Dec 31 2025, 11:30 PM.Aug 28 2025, 5:05 PM
Reedy changed the task status from Open to In Progress.Dec 16 2025, 6:30 PM
Reedy triaged this task as High priority.
Reedy updated the task description. (Show Details)

Change #1221640 had a related patch set uploaded (by Reedy; author: Reedy):

[operations/mediawiki-config@master] CommonSettings: Remove EOL REL1_39 from ExtensionDistributor

https://gerrit.wikimedia.org/r/1221640

Change #1221641 had a related patch set uploaded (by Reedy; author: Reedy):

[translatewiki@master] autobackport: Mark REL1_39 as inactive

https://gerrit.wikimedia.org/r/1221641

Change #1221642 had a related patch set uploaded (by Reedy; author: Reedy):

[translatewiki@master] autobackport: Remove REL1_39

https://gerrit.wikimedia.org/r/1221642

Change #1221644 had a related patch set uploaded (by Reedy; author: Reedy):

[integration/config@master] zuul: Drop CI for REL1_39

https://gerrit.wikimedia.org/r/1221644

Change #1221644 merged by jenkins-bot:

[integration/config@master] zuul: Drop CI for REL1_39

https://gerrit.wikimedia.org/r/1221644

Change #1221641 merged by jenkins-bot:

[translatewiki@master] autobackport: Mark REL1_39 as inactive

https://gerrit.wikimedia.org/r/1221641

Change #1221640 merged by jenkins-bot:

[operations/mediawiki-config@master] CommonSettings: Remove EOL REL1_39 from ExtensionDistributor

https://gerrit.wikimedia.org/r/1221640

Mentioned in SAL (#wikimedia-operations) [2026-01-05T14:23:22Z] <stran@deploy2002> Started scap sync-world: Backport for [[gerrit:1210681|trwikisource: Create rollbacker user group (T410931)]], [[gerrit:1219219|Enable protection indicators for ruwiki]], [[gerrit:1221640|CommonSettings: Remove EOL REL1_39 from ExtensionDistributor (T403199)]]

Mentioned in SAL (#wikimedia-operations) [2026-01-05T14:25:17Z] <stran@deploy2002> reedy, stran, neriah: Backport for [[gerrit:1210681|trwikisource: Create rollbacker user group (T410931)]], [[gerrit:1219219|Enable protection indicators for ruwiki]], [[gerrit:1221640|CommonSettings: Remove EOL REL1_39 from ExtensionDistributor (T403199)]] synced to the testservers (see https://wikitech.wikimedia.org/wiki/Mwdebug). Changes can now be verified there.

Mentioned in SAL (#wikimedia-operations) [2026-01-05T14:43:53Z] <stran@deploy2002> Finished scap sync-world: Backport for [[gerrit:1210681|trwikisource: Create rollbacker user group (T410931)]], [[gerrit:1219219|Enable protection indicators for ruwiki]], [[gerrit:1221640|CommonSettings: Remove EOL REL1_39 from ExtensionDistributor (T403199)]] (duration: 20m 31s)

Change #1221642 merged by jenkins-bot:

[translatewiki@master] autobackport: Remove REL1_39

https://gerrit.wikimedia.org/r/1221642